Buffer is a widely adopted social media management platform known for its clean interface and reliable scheduling capabilities, making it a popular choice among consulting firms seeking simplicity and reliability. According to their website, Buffer allows users to schedule posts across major platforms including Facebook, Instagram, Twitter, LinkedIn, and Pinterest with a unified calendar view. It offers analytics dashboards that track engagement metrics and optimize posting times based on historical performance. Buffer’s team collaboration features enable multiple users to review and approve content before publishing, which supports the workflow needs of consulting teams. The platform also includes a browser extension for quick content sharing and a content library to store and reuse approved posts. While it doesn’t offer AI-generated content or research insights, Buffer excels at providing a streamlined, human-managed approach to maintaining a consistent social presence. For consultants who prefer to craft their own messaging and focus on calendar organization rather than automation, Buffer delivers a dependable, low-friction experience. Its mobile app ensures content management is possible on the go, which suits consultants who travel frequently or manage multiple client engagements.

Hootsuite is a comprehensive social media management platform trusted by enterprises and mid-sized consulting firms for its extensive platform support and workflow automation. According to their website, Hootsuite enables users to schedule, publish, and monitor content across more than 35 social networks, including TikTok, LinkedIn, Instagram, YouTube, and X. It features a visual content calendar that allows users to drag and drop posts, assign team members, and track performance in real time. The platform also includes social listening tools to monitor brand mentions and industry keywords, as well as team collaboration features like approval workflows and role-based permissions. Hootsuite’s analytics suite provides detailed reports on engagement, reach, and follower growth, helping consulting firms measure the ROI of their content efforts. While Hootsuite offers integrations with third-party tools like Google Analytics and Salesforce, it does not generate content or conduct AI-driven research. Its strength lies in centralized control and monitoring rather than automated creation. For firms that need broad platform coverage and want to manage both publishing and social monitoring in one place, Hootsuite provides a mature, enterprise-grade solution.
